本文へスキップ

技術士試験(情報工学部門)・情報技術者試験。ファーストマクロ。


Since 2016.4.19

平成31年度 春期 基本情報技術者試験問題と解説

問28

関係モデルにおいて表Xから表Yを得る関係演算はどれか。

  X                 Y
 ┌────┬────┬───┬──┐┌────┬──┐
 │商品番号│ 商品名 │ 価格 │数量││商品番号│数量│
 ┝━━━━┿━━━━┿━━━┿━━┥┝━━━━┿━━┥
 │ A01 │カメラ │13,000│ 20││ A01 │ 20│
 ├────┼────┼───┼──┤├────┼──┤
 │ A02 │テレビ │58,000│ 15││ A02 │ 15│
 ├────┼────┼───┼──┤├────┼──┤
 │ B01 │冷藏庫 │65,000│  8││ B01 │  8│
 ├────┼────┼───┼──┤├────┼──┤
 │ B05 │洗濯機 │48,000│ 10││ B05 │ 10│
 ├────┼────┼───┼──┤├────┼──┤
 │ B06 │乾燥機 │35,000│  5││ B06 │  5│
 └────┴────┴───┴──┘└────┴──┘

ア 結合 (join)

イ 射影 (projection)

ウ 選択 (selection)

エ 併合 (merge)


正解


解説

ア 結合は、複数の表に共通する列を基準に1つの表にまとめることである。
イ 正しい。射影は、表から必要な列を取り出すことである。
ウ 選択は、表から必要な行を取り出すことである。
エ 併合は、同じ列を持った複数の表をひとつの表にまとめることである。

問27 目次 問29